confederation

英 [kənˌfedəˈreɪʃn]

美 [kənˌfedəˈreɪʃn]

n.  联盟; 联合体; 加拿大联邦(从1867年7月1日起由若干省和地方组成加拿大)

复数:confederations 

Collins.2 / BNC.8239 / COCA.18262

牛津词典

    noun

    • 联盟;联合体
      an organization consisting of countries, businesses, etc. that have joined together in order to help each other
      1. the Confederation of British Industry
        英国工业联合会
    • 加拿大联邦(从1867年7月1日起由若干省和地方组成加拿大)
      (in Canada) the joining together of provinces and territories forming Canada, which began 1 July, 1867

      柯林斯词典

      • N-COUNT; N-IN-NAMES (尤指为商业或政治目的而组成的)联盟,同盟,联合会
        Aconfederationis an organization or group consisting of smaller groups or states, especially one that exists for business or political purposes.
        1. ...the Confederation of Indian Industry.
          印度产业联合会
        2. ...plans to partition the republic into a confederation of mini-states.
          把共和国分割成小国邦联的计划
